ORTELIUS, ABRAHAM. 1527-1598.

Americae sive novi orbis nova descriptio. Antwerp: [1571].
Hand-colored double-page engraved map, 366 x 476 mm, Latin text on verso, with ornamental cartouche, ships and sea creature. Framed. Even toning, some slight darkening at centerfold, margins somewhat brief, but present, an attractive example overall.

"One of the most famous and easily recognizable maps of America" (Burden). First plate (of 3) with 7mm thick strapwork border of interwoven circle and diamond design, the largest ship in the Pacific sailing westwards and graduations between the longitudinal marks. Second state with the Azores correctly labeled, but with second line of text ("dinem...") flush with the left margin. The first issue is particularly scarce and differs only in the labeling of Canarie insuale. The Chilean coastline with the large protuberance is one of the most noticeable features on this plate and wasn't corrected until the third plate. Burden Mapping of North America 39 (pictured on jacket); Tooley Mapping of America p 320; Wheat Northwest Coast 80.
